Season trivia for Ligue 2 2020/2021

It's not all about becoming the top scorer or winning matches - there's also a wealth of fascinating information related to goalscorers and other remarkable records. Below, you'll find trivia and interesting facts from the 2020/2021 Ligue 2 season in France.

Best scoring couple

The top goal-scoring pair, in other words two players where one scored the goal and the other player assisted to it, were Mickaël Le Bihan and Mathias Autret. Together they were behind 7 goals for Auxerre in the 2020/2021 season.

Fastest hat-trick

Mohamed Bayo, playing for Clermont, was the player who scored the fastest hat-trick. In the space of 13 minutes, he scored three goals in the match between Clermont-USL Dunkerque.

Most braces by player

Mickaël Le Bihan in Auxerre scored (at least) two goals in a match 5 times and was thus the player who scored the most braces in matches during the 2020/2021 season.

Most first goals in a match

The player who scored the first goal in a match the most times during the 2020/2021 season was Pape Ibnou Ba in Chamois Niortais, in total he did it 10 times.

Most penalty goals by player

The best penalty taker in the league during the 2020/2021 season was Stijn Spierings, in total he scored 7 penalties for his Toulouse.

Most penalty goals by team

Most goals from the penalty spot was a feat shared by 2 teams, and the teams that each scored 10 penalty goals were Toulouse and Troyes.

Most stoppage time goals by player

Yoann Touzghar was the player who scored the most stoppage time goals during the 2020/2021 season, in total he scored 3 stoppage time goals for his Troyes.

Most stoppage time goals by team

The highest number of goals in added time by a team was 6 goals, which 3 teams managed to do, and these were Toulouse, Grenoble and Amiens.

Most own goals by team

Nancy scored 7 own goals in all their matches, making them the “best” at it in the entire league during the 2020/2021 season.

Players with goals in most consecutive matches

There were 2 players who scored in 6 consecutive matches during the 2020/2021 season, and the players who achieved this were Yoann Touzghar (Troyes) and Rhys Healey (Toulouse).

Players with assists in most consecutive matches

It was Mickaël Le Bihan in Auxerre who had the longest streak of matches in a row with at least one assist, achieving this in 4 consecutive matches.

Players with goals or assists in most consecutive matches

Rhys Healey in Toulouse scored or assisted in 7 consecutive matches during the 2020/2021 season, which was the best in the league.

Players with most goals in the first half

It was Mickaël Le Bihan in Auxerre who scored the most goals in the first half, with a total of 12 goals in the first half of the match.

Players with most goals in the second half

Mohamed Bayo in Clermont scored a total of 15 goals in the second half, including stoppage time, which was the best in Ligue 2 during the 2020/2021 season.

Most consecutive wins

There were 2 teams that had 5 consecutive wins in the 2020/2021 season, and those teams were Troyes and Paris FC.

Most matches in a row without losing

Auxerre were the team with the longest unbeaten run during the 2020/2021 season, playing 13 straight matches without losing.

Most consecutive losses

Pau had a streak of 6 consecutive losses, something no other team surpassed in Ligue 2 during the 2020/2021 season.

Most matches in a row without a win

Rodez managed the feat of not winning a single match in 14 consecutive matches during the 2020/2021 season, something they did best among all the teams in the league.

Most comebacks from behind to win

The art of turning a deficit in a match into a win is something Auxerre were best at during the 2020/2021 season, they came back to win 4 matches in total.

Most blown leads resulting in losses

Chambly and Nancy were the teams that struggled most to win despite taking the lead, these teams blew a lead and lost in 5 different matches during the 2020/2021 season.
